Transaction 097604ece526fa067c7d5569ac25fa4242124d3777cc0343c420c3e7c9a00565
1 Input
1 Output
-
097604ece526fa067c7d5569ac25fa4242124d3777cc0343c420c3e7c9a00565:0
- value
- 866190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85caaa600264267bec959b372d9b06e2041cc785 OP_EQUAL
- address
- 3DtSaWEnPHX3bDwwt5HS76qg2vA8WVew3D